Cerence, a leading brand in the production of artificial intelligence-based systems dedicated to the automotive world, presented Co-Pilot at CES 2022. An innovative system that transforms the in-car assistant into a proactive co-pilot. The increase in available data, IoT ( Internet of Things ) devices and the strengthening of algorithms, in fact, offer assistants increasingly valuable assistance to anticipate people's requests .

Proactive and multimodal voice AI , in fact, analyzes data from the car's sensors and human behavior to predict the driver's desires, and supports him like never before. Today, with the introduction of Cerence Co-Pilot, we place Cerence firmly at the center of reinventing what it means to drive a modern car .
Voice-powered interaction has become ubiquitous in our daily lives, but it's time that we expand upon its capabilities and chart the road ahead – a fully multi-modal, multi-sensor, AI-based experience. By bringing a new level of intelligence to the voice assistant, we not only enhance comfort and convenience, but also improve safety through proactive and reactive capabilities”. - Stefan Ortmanns , CEO, Cerence Proactivity plays an important role in improving driver safety , for example by alerting him to periodic maintenance or unexpected problems ( a drop in oil or tire pressure, etc. ); and providing real-time information , such as impending adverse weather conditions, while also offering the ability to put the car into the appropriate driving mode. With proactive capabilities, the system can make even everyday travel easier and more intuitive.
